理解 xchg指令:探索其含义和用途
xchg指令是指交换两个操作数的指令。在汇编语言和低级编程中使用。
理解 xchg指令的意思。
xchg指令的主要功能是交换两个操作数的值。在汇编语言中,它用于交换寄存器的数值和内存地址的数据。这样的指令在编写高效程序时非常有用。
探索 xchg指令的应用
xchg指令在实际编程中有很多用途。例如,在并发编程中,它可以用来实现线程之间的安全数据交换。在加密算法中,用于密钥和数据块的交换。性能的最优化这一点,xchg指令也被用于减少访问内存的次数,提高程序的执行效率。
xchg指令的用法。
在汇编语言中使用xchg指令需要考虑操作数的类型和内存的位置。程序员需要确保指令被正确使用,以免出现错误的结果或程序崩溃。同时,合理的使用xchg指令也可以优化程序的性能,提高执行效率。
总结
xchg指令,是为了交换操作的数值的重要指令,在计算机编程中被用在各种各样的用途。理解并熟练使用xchg指令对于高效安全的程序是非常重要的。
通过学习和探索xchg指令的含义和用途,可以更好地应用它来解决实际的编程问题,提高程序的性能和安全性。